Why Legal Professionals Need Machine-Bound File Protection

In my experience, PDFs, videos, and other digital files related to legal cases are a goldmine of critical info and often the target of unauthorized access or illegal distribution. You might think password protection alone is enough, but it's not. Passwords get shared, copied, or cracked. What you really want is to lock down access to specific machines or devices, ensuring that even if someone gets a hold of your files, they can't open them elsewhere.

What is VeryPDF Easy DRM Protector?

At its core, VeryPDF Easy DRM Protector is a digital content encryption tool. It encrypts all kinds of files PDFs, eBooks, videos, audio, images, and other e-learning materials so only authorised users can open and view them. But what makes it stand out for legal professionals is its ability to bind encrypted content to specific PCs, USB drives, or even CDs/DVDs.

Key Features That Stand Out in Real-World Use

When I first started using Easy DRM Protector, these features blew me away:

1. PC-Binding Encryption:

One password, one computer. The file is locked to a specific machine's hardware ID. So even if someone copies the encrypted file and password, they won't get far opening it on a different device. This is a massive advantage when dealing with confidential legal evidence files.

Example: I shared a set of scanned contracts with an external compliance team. By PC-binding the files, I made sure only their specific office computers could access the documents. No risk of files being opened elsewhere or leaked.

2. Multiple Binding Modes:

Besides PC-binding, you can bind files to USB drives or CDs/DVDs. This flexibility is crucial in legal environments where data may need to be transported physically under strict controls.

3. Government-Level AES Encryption:

The encryption is strong the same AES standard the NSA uses for top-secret documents. That gave me peace of mind that the files couldn't be decrypted by anyone without proper authorization.

4. No Waiting or Temporary Files:

Unlike typical zip encryption tools, where you wait ages for unzipping, Easy DRM Protector pops up a password prompt instantly. This is a practical time saver when working with large legal files.

5. Watermarking:

Adding dynamic watermarks to videos or PDFs with custom fonts and positioning means each user's file is personalised. This discourages leaks and makes it easier to track any unauthorized sharing.

FAQs

Q1: Can I restrict encrypted files to only one computer?

Yes, with PC-binding encryption mode, a file can only be opened on the designated computer's hardware.

Q2: What types of digital content does Easy DRM Protector support?

It supports PDFs, eBooks, videos, audio, images, and e-learning content.

Q3: Is it possible to add watermarks to protected videos?

Yes, you can add both floating and fixed watermarks with custom fonts and colours.

Q4: How does the password blacklist feature work?

You can upload a blacklist to your server, and the software will block playback passwords on the blacklist, preventing unauthorized access.

Q5: Do users need to install software to open encrypted EXE files?

No, EXE files encrypted by Easy DRM Protector can be opened directly without installing additional software.
